La melatonina (N-acetil-5 metoxytryptamine) que es sintetitza a partir de triptòfan, es forma durant la fermentació alcohòlica, no obstant el seu paper en el llevat és desconegut. Aquest estudi va utilitzar espècies de Saccharomyces i no Saccharomyces per avaluar els possibles efectes antioxidants de melatonina. Es va avaluar la resistència al H2O2, la producció d'espècies reactives d'oxigen, la peroxidació lipídica, l'activitat catalasa i a la composició lipídica (àcids grassos, fosfolípids i esterols) tant en llevats de Saccharomyces com no-Saccharomyces. A més, a S. cerevisiae es va avaluar el contingut de glutatió reduït i oxidat, es va quantificar la melatonina endògena i es va realitzar un assaig transcriptòmic. Els resultats van mostrar que els llevats que contenen àcids grassos insaturats com els àcids linoleic o linolènic són més tolerants a l'estrès oxidatiu. Per altra banda, la suplementació amb melatonina va facilitar que les cèl·lules fessin front a possibles estressos futurs. Tanmateix, quan les cèl·lules van ser sotmeses a estrès oxidatiu induït per H2O2, la melatonina va poder mitigar parcialment el dany cel·lular reduint la producció de ROS, la peroxidació de lípids i el glutatió oxidat a la vegada que augmentava el glutatió reduït i la viabilitat cel·lular. L̀anàlisi de transcriptòmica va demostrar que la melatonina és capaç de modular la resposta a l'estrès oxidatiu a nivell transcripcional. Els resultats demostren que la melatonina pot actuar com antioxidant tant en llevats Saccharomyces com en no-Saccharomyces.

La melatonina és una indolamina que és produïda pel llevat a partir de l'aminoàcid triptòfan durant la fermentació alcohòlica. En aquesta tesi, estudiem la producció de melatonina en most sintètic en diferents condicions ambientals i nutricionals pels llevats, així com l'efecte d'aquesta molècula bioactiva en la dinàmica de poblacions d'una fermentació. Com a resultats, observem que la detecció estava desfasada entre la producció intracel·lular, la qual va ocórrer durant la fase d'adaptació al medi i la secreció al medi extracel·lular durant la fase exponencial o estacionària. Així mateix, la presència de melatonina millorava el desenvolupament de la fermentació i augmentava la presència de llevats no-Saccharomyces a final de fermentació. A més, vam analitzar la interacció d'aquesta molècula amb proteïnes durant la fermentació. Els resultats van mostrar que la melatonina s'unia a enzims glicolítics en llevats que tenien una alta capacitat fermentativa, reforçant la idea que la melatonina podria actuar com una molècula senyal durant la fermentació alcohòlica. Finalment, es va optimitzar un nou mètode de detecció per fluorescència utilitzant una línia cel·lular que presenta el receptor humà de melatonina per a mostres procedents de begudes fermentades. Els resultats van mostrar que aquest nou mètode disminueix el límit de detecció i és una bona alternativa en comparació amb el mètode de detecció de melatonina basat en cromatografia. No obstant, es necessita una extracció de la mostra per a realitzar l'anàlisi de melatonina.

"This new edition presents information on how melatonin is synthesized and produced in the body as well as how this hormone affects several diseases. The book heavily focuses on prevention as well as treatment of various human disease states including behavior disorders, mental disorders, breast cancer, bone health, and gastrointestinal diseases. It covers the role of melatonin in the prevention of oxidative stress, mutagenesis, sun damage, ocular health, gut motility, and detoxification. It also presents mechanisms of melatonin action in humans including cell modulation, signaling mechanisms, protective effects, and melatonin receptors as well as its role as an antioxidant"--Provided by publisher.

"The exponential influx of scientific research on melatonin is associated with a greater orientation towards the study of the systemic effects of melatonin and their derivatives, as well as their clinical implications. Proof of this fact is summarized in the present compilation, where melatonin is presented as a remarkable agent to counteract most of the physiopathological events that trigger several disorders. The book also collects evidence about melatonin's interactions with two high-affinity G protein-coupled receptors to provide new pharmacological targets for the treatment of cancer, neurological or endocrine conditions. The present review also includes detailed coverage of molecules with improved safety profiles and melatonin receptor agonists (such as ramelteon, tasimelteon, and agomelatine), and the latest findings on the role of melatonin in protecting plants from abiotic stress, improving their resistance to adverse conditions, regulating several environmental stresses including heat stress, as well as the clinical use of melatonin in the treatment of fertility-related problems and reproductive health. The multiplicity of actions of melatonin, including modulating immune responses and inflammation and maintaining mitochondrial integrity, make this indoleamine a valuable therapeutic agent in the treatment of neurodegeneration, polycystic ovary syndrome, brain ischemia and traumatic brain injury, fibromyalgia, optic neuritis and glaucoma, alone or in combination with other drugs. Melatonin easily crosses the blood-brain and placental barriers. In this sense, this book provides a complete review suggesting that melatonin supplementation should be considered as a potential disease-preventing agent, with the aim of extending pregnancy duration to improve clinical outcomes and prevent fetal brain damage for pregnancy pathologies, such as preeclampsia, intrauterine growth restriction and preterm birth. Within the last few decades, melatonin has emerged in clinical oncology as a naturally occurring bioactive molecule with substantial anticancer properties. In addition, this chronobiotic agent exerts oncostatic effects throughout all stages of tumor growth, from initial cell transformation to mitigation of malignant progression and metastasis. Its therapeutic applications in oral cancer, gastrointestinal pathologies and colorectal cancer are discussed, as well as its applications as an adjuvant for alleviating side-effects and improving the welfare of radio/chemotherapy-treated patients. In the final chapter, the authors summarize the indications for the development of new galenic formulations of melatonin. Thus, different melatonin formulations, such as intranasal solutions, sprays, microspheres, gels and liposomes would allow for the maintenance of endogenous active concentrations for a long time, avoiding poor oral bioavailability"--
